SSH > Secure Shell - De cero a experto
4.6 (35 ratings)
Course Ratings are calculated from individual students’ ratings and a variety of other signals, like age of rating and reliability, to ensure that they reflect course quality fairly and accurately.
212 students enrolled

SSH > Secure Shell - De cero a experto

Aprende a usar SSH a nivel ninja
4.6 (35 ratings)
Course Ratings are calculated from individual students’ ratings and a variety of other signals, like age of rating and reliability, to ensure that they reflect course quality fairly and accurately.
212 students enrolled
Created by Diego Córdoba
Last updated 4/2020
Spanish
Spanish [Auto-generated]
Current price: $38.99 Original price: $59.99 Discount: 35% off
14 hours left at this price!
30-Day Money-Back Guarantee
This course includes
  • 5.5 hours on-demand video
  • 3 articles
  • Full lifetime access
  • Access on mobile and TV
  • Certificate of Completion
Training 5 or more people?

Get your team access to 4,000+ top Udemy courses anytime, anywhere.

Try Udemy for Business
What you'll learn
  • Administrar sistemas remotamente utilizando SSH por terminal
  • Ejecución de aplicaciones gráficas y comandos de la shell remotos mediante un túnel cifrado en capa de aplicación
  • Transferencia de archivos entre equipos remotos mediante diversas herramientas provistas por SSH
  • Montaje de sistemas de archivos remotos sobre un túnel cifrado SSH
  • Configuración segura del servicio
  • Uso de clave pública y privada para acceder a los servidores SSH (muy usado por los proveedores de cloud computing)
  • Acceso reverso a un cliente que conecte contra un servicio SSH
  • Tunelización de protocolos de capa superior sobre un túnel SSH
  • Configuración de una VPN (Virtual Private Network) basada en SSH
Requirements
  • Conocimientos básicos de operación GNU/Linux
  • Conocimientos básicos del manejo de la línea de comandos / shell
  • Conocimientos básicos de servicios de red, puertos, y protocolos TCP/IP.
Description

Si eres operador GNU/Linux, o sysadmin, o administrador de red, o incluso programador o administrador Windows y necesitas interactuar con sistemas GNU/Linux, este curso va a interesarte!!

SSH, siglas de Secure Shell, es un protocolo de capa de aplicación que permite y facilita un montón de tareas, incluidas:

  • Conexión a una terminal de comandos remota.

  • Ejecución remota de comandos en un servidor.

  • Transferencia de archivos.

  • Montaje de proxy's SOCKS para mejorar la privacidad de usuario o saltar firewalls.

  • Montaje de un sistema de archivos remoto sobre un punto de montaje local.

  • Montaje de un túnel ssh reverso para dar soporte remoto a equipos Linux que no sean accesibles en Internet.

  • Montaje de una VPN sobre túneles cifrados SSH y direccionamiento a los hosts.

  • Reenvío de un puerto local a un servidor remoto sobre un túnel seguro.

  • ... y muchas cosas más!

SSH es mi protocolo favorito en mis tareas de sysadmin, programador y docente/instructor GNU/Linux, me permite enormes facilidades a la hora de interactuar con servidores remotos, y en este curso he tratado de volcar muchas de las herramientas que suelo utilizar habitualmente (y otras no tan habituales :) ).

--------------------------------

NOTA: en versión beta

El curso actualmente está en versión beta (y a precio reducido por tiempo limitado).

En las próximas actualizaciones se publicará contenido referente a:

  • Guías prácticas para que puedas poner a prueba lo que has aprendido!

Who this course is for:
  • Administradores de sistemas GNU/Linux
  • Administradores de redes basadas en GNU/Linux
  • Programadores que necesiten utilizar la terminal de comandos GNU/Linux para editar sus códigos fuente remotos
  • Cualquier usuario GNU/Linux que quiera aprender una excelente herramienta de administración remota de sistemas.
Course content
Expand all 46 lectures 05:28:50
+ Introducción y uso
10 lectures 01:14:39
Bienvenid@!! Notas iniciales
01:27
Arquitectura del protocolo (resumen)
06:52
Ejemplo de conexión - Parte 1
06:57
Ejemplo de conexión - Parte 2
07:43
Ejemplo de conexión - Parte 3
05:31
Archivos de configuración - Parte 1
05:04
Archivos de configuración - Parte 2
11:44
Ejecución de comandos remotos
08:19
+ Transferencia de archivos
7 lectures 51:47
Scp - secure copy
04:39
sftp - secure FTP - Parte 1
06:46
sftp - secure FTP - Parte 2
08:33
sftp - secure FTP - Parte 3
05:36

En este video aprenderemos a configurar, por razones de seguridad, el chroot de un servicio sftp.

NUEVO: sftp - secure FTP - Configuración chroot
08:24
SSHFS - SSH FileSystem
10:09
Filezilla y gftp como clientes gráficos en Linux
07:40
+ Extensiones y otras herramientas
16 lectures 02:01:43
Montando un proxy SOCKS sobre SSH
08:45
Montando un túnel SSH reverso - Parte 1
07:44
Montando un túnel SSH reverso - Parte 2
11:11

Material extraído del vlog de @juncotic

Tunelizando MySQL (o cualquier servicio) al host local
09:50
Clientes SSH en Windows
07:45
MySQL Workbench conectando con SSH
07:52
DBeaver conectando con SSH
06:36
Reenvío de puertos por túnel SSH
10:49
Reenvío de túnel SSH - Forwarder SSH
08:05
VPN sobre SSL - Parte 2
05:24
VPN sobre SSL - Parte 3
03:41
VPN sobre SSL - Parte 4
07:05
VPN sobre SSL - Parte 5
08:22
VPN sobre SSL - Parte 6
04:53
VPN sobre SSL - Parte 7
07:01
+ Algunas configuraciones
10 lectures 01:06:04

En esta oportunidad veremos cómo podemos configurar un servidor de SSH, y cómo testear configuraciones y ejecutar servidores temporales para hacer pruebas. Parte 1.

Conceptos de configuración del servidor - Parte 1
06:29

En esta oportunidad veremos cómo podemos configurar un servidor de SSH, y cómo testear configuraciones y ejecutar servidores temporales para hacer pruebas. Parte 2.

Conceptos de configuración del servidor - Parte 2
08:42
Configuración cliente (conceptos) - Parte 1
05:10
Configuración cliente (conceptos) - Parte 2
03:52
Configuración cliente (conceptos) - Parte 3
04:26
NUEVO: Hardening - Algunos consejos de configuración en el servidor
08:40
NUEVO: Hardening - AllowUsers y AllowGroups
08:17
NUEVO: Hardening - DenyUsers, DenyGroups, Match
07:46
NUEVO: Hardening - Ejecución de comandos en la conexión
06:23
+ BONUS
3 lectures 14:37
OPCIONAL: Introducción básica a TCP/IP (Artículo)
04:43
OPCIONAL: Introducción a TCP/IP (Video)
07:51

Udemy nos permite a los instructores facilitarles algunos beneficios a nuestros alumnos. En esta clase extra (Bonus Lecture) podrás encontrar mis otros cursos, y accesos al mínimo precio sólo disponibles para alumnos.

¡¡¡ CLASE EXTRA / BONUS !!!
02:02